Changing Conservatory Door Handles
Most people can easily alter the handles of their conservatory door lock repair door. It is important to first find out if your current handles are spring-loaded or not.
We have a variety of replacement handles for the majority of uPVC double-glazing companies, including Hoppe Mila Avocet & the Fab n'Fix. To choose the best handle for your door, you must be sure to check two crucial measurements that are the distance between the screw fixing centres and the center of the key hole (also known as PZ centres).
Lever/lever
You might want to alter the handle style when you install new uPVC doors for your conservatory window repairs. The finish of your handles can be a significant difference in the appearance of the space, as well as the security level that you need. It's relatively simple to change a door handle. The majority of people can do it themselves in less than five minutes.
It is crucial to shut the door and secure it prior to when you begin this process. This will ensure that you are working in a safe environment. After that, you'll need remove the handle and the cylinder lock. After the handle and cylinder lock are removed, you'll need to mark the screw holes on your back plate. This will allow you to determine the precise location to screw your replacement handle into the hole. Once marked you can then make use of these measurements to purchase the correct handle for your uPVC door.
The screws, replacement Conservatory door Handles levers and pad spindles all go through the lock case that is located inside the door. This means that you can't simply swap one handle for another without ensuring that they're properly matched. This is why it's essential to take accurate measurements before buying a new set of handles.
You'll also need to take measurements of the Top Screw to Spindle Distance and PZ Dimension (centre of euro hole for cylinders). Then you'll need to pick the best uPVC handle for your home. To assist you with this, we've put together a handy door handle measurement guide that will show you exactly what to look out for when assessing your uPVC door.
